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Mozilla Firefox versions prior to 1.5.0.5 Thunderbird versions prior to 1.5.0.5 SeaMonkey versions prior to 1.0.3
Description The issue allows remote attackers to hijack native DOM methods from objects in another domain and conduct c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ks using DOM methods of the top-level object.
Recommendations For Mozilla Firefox versions prior to 1.5.0.5, update to version 1.5.0.5 or later. For Thunderbird versions prior to 1.5.0.5, update to version 1.5.0.5 or later. For SeaMonkey versions prior to 1.0.3, update to version 1.0.3 or later.
